Subject & Meaning

The subject, identified as Lorenz Spengler, is shown with a small object in his right hand and his left hand resting on a globe, suggesting his intellectual or professional pursuits. His confident pose conveys a sense of pride in his role as Ivory Turner and Curator of the Royal Danish Kunstkammer.

Technique & Style

The painting employs chiaroscuro, a technique characterized by strong contrasts between light and dark. The dark background focuses attention on the subject's face and attire, while the use of light highlights the details of his clothing and the objects he holds.
